I was 27 years old, 5’9”, 300 lbs. and for my age I had high blood pressure which is steadily heading towards the snowballed effect of heart disease in my family. Getting out of breath during badminton games at family gatherings shouldn’t happen and walking through aisles at the supermarket and movies sometimes felt like an issue.
4 years ago my job delivering mail forced me to be in the best shape of my life. But it’s been three years since I crashed the mail truck and lost any health benefits that I gained from carrying the bag. The opportunity to get back into a healthier routine came when “Strength and Fitness” moved right next door to my current office job.
Previously, I belonged to a more commercialized gym and I immediately began to notice the difference between gym employees and the family owned business that is “Strength and Fitness”. At other gyms you get your standard “Hi, how are you” greeting, but at S&F, if you have the time Doug or his mother, Lynn ask about your weekend, how your workouts are going, and if you need help with anything. They are quick to point out the free classes that are available to their members and if any schedule changes are taking place.
When I first signed up for S&F I was approached about hiring a personal trainer. The important thing to note is that I was approached the one time and that was it. At my previous gym I was constantly asked about a trainer, sometimes 3 or 4 times a week by the same guy. I don’t even think he remembered talking to me and was just going through his sales pitch.
After a month of doing my own routine I took advantage of the free hour with Mike Brown, the head personal trainer. In that hour I learned that I didn’t know what working out really was. I signed up the next day. With Mike I’m learning how to work out to my fullest capacity and how to form a routine that keeps me going. He showed me the difference between having healthy habits and having a healthy lifestyle. Every week we review my eating habits and although it had to change slightly, it’s only because I was eating all the wrong things. Mike explains the importance of protein in your diet and the real secret as to why non-nutritious carbs can be so dangerous.
I joined the gym in April 2008 and its now September. I’ve lost about 50 pounds so far and my blood pressure has dropped considerably. I can run for a good 20-30 minutes straight and have the motivation to push myself to go further every day. With my experience other gyms are looking to make their sales quota, the family at Strength and Fitness are looking to make their members live that healthier lifestyle that we all want.
